是指在数据表格中记录和追踪数据的变化情况。通过跟踪表格中的变化,可以实时监控数据的修改、删除和新增操作,以便及时发现和解决数据错误或异常。
跟踪表格中的变化可以通过以下几种方式实现:
- 数据库触发器:数据库触发器是一种在数据库中定义的特殊程序,可以在数据表中的操作(如插入、更新、删除)发生时自动触发执行。通过在表格上创建触发器,可以在数据发生变化时记录相关信息,如变化的时间、操作类型、修改前后的值等。
- 日志文件:数据库系统通常会记录所有的数据库操作日志,包括数据的修改、删除和新增等操作。通过分析数据库的日志文件,可以获取到表格中的变化情况。
- 版本控制系统:使用版本控制系统(如Git)可以跟踪表格中的变化。每次对表格进行修改时,可以将修改的内容提交到版本控制系统中,系统会记录每次提交的变化,包括修改的内容、时间和提交者等信息。
跟踪表格中的变化在许多应用场景中都非常有用,例如:
- 数据审计:在金融、医疗等领域,对数据的修改和访问需要进行严格的审计。通过跟踪表格中的变化,可以追踪数据的修改历史,确保数据的完整性和可追溯性。
- 故障排查:当系统出现问题时,跟踪表格中的变化可以帮助开发人员快速定位问题所在。通过分析数据的变化情况,可以找到导致问题的操作或数据异常。
- 数据恢复:当数据发生错误或丢失时,可以通过跟踪表格中的变化来恢复数据。通过回溯数据的修改历史,可以找回之前正确的数据状态。
腾讯云提供了一些相关的产品和服务,可以帮助实现跟踪表格中的变化,例如:
- 腾讯云数据库审计(https://cloud.tencent.com/product/das):提供了数据库操作审计的功能,可以记录数据库的操作日志,包括表格中的变化情况。
- 腾讯云日志服务(https://cloud.tencent.com/product/cls):提供了日志管理和分析的功能,可以帮助分析数据库的日志文件,获取表格中的变化信息。
以上是关于跟踪表格中的变化的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!